Masu'ot Yitzhak is a moshav shitufi in southern . Located near , it falls under the jurisdiction of Shafir Regional Council. The original kibbutz in was destroyed and depopulated in the 1948 Arab–Israeli War, and a new settlement was established in 1949 in a different location.

Giv'ati is a moshav in southern . Located near , it falls under the jurisdiction of Be'er Tuvia Regional Council. In 2023 it had a population of 1,109.
